Immerse yourself in the timeless elegance of Domenico Scarlatti's sonatas, beautifully arranged for guitar by the legendary Narciso Yepes. This album, released on January 1, 1988, under the prestigious Deutsche Grammophon label, offers a captivating journey through the masterful compositions of one of the most prolific keyboard composers of the Baroque era.
Domenico Scarlatti, born in 1685, spent the latter part of his life composing over 550 sonatas for keyboard, primarily for his royal pupil. This album features a selection of these sonatas, meticulously arranged for guitar, showcasing the versatility and enduring appeal of Scarlatti's music. Each track, from the Sonata in G Major, K. 146, to the Sonata in B Major, K. 377, is a testament to Scarlatti's genius and Yepes' virtuosity.
The album spans a duration of 46 minutes, providing a concise yet comprehensive exploration of Scarlatti's sonatas.
